Transaction 39f8be625f75b35df661afe383a8f1374243c600bc2898327f6d5dfde1819253
1 Input
1 Output
-
39f8be625f75b35df661afe383a8f1374243c600bc2898327f6d5dfde1819253:0
- value
- 5650086
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5ec74bb6da3cfeb449e35d5793a6aa52e48ff33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mxj1BPEYSf9jLmveL4jz5XgjXtUnwYPor